The information can be found in your owners manual. As for the turbo timer, you can install one with the immobilizer. You would just splice and connect the ignition wire from the Turbo timer to the wire located underneath the steering column cover. It's sort of hard to explain but if you have the electrical diagram for the car you should be able to install it.
